COEP Pune Admission 2026 offers 1,230 BTech seats across 9 branches at COEP Technological University, primarily through MHT CET for 80% Maharashtra seats and JEE Main for 20% All India quota. Admissions follow centralized CAP counseling by Maharashtra CET Cell, with no direct institute entries.
Eligibility requires passing 10+2 with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ics at 45% aggregate (40% for reserved Maharashtra candidates) and a valid entrance score. Non-Maharashtra applicants must qualify via JEE Main.
Tentative dates include MHT CET registration from December 30, 2025, to February 15, 2026, with exams in April 2026. CAP rounds start June-July 2026.
The application process involves online registration at cetcell.mahacet.org, fee of INR 1,000 for general, followed by document verification and seat allotment.
Fees for 2026 total INR 146,704 annually for open category, including tuition INR 77,000, development INR 24,674, and others INR 45,030. Reserved categories pay reduced amounts post-reimbursements.

Admission fees for 2025-26 vary by category, with open paying full at confirmation during CAP. No refunds post-allotment acceptance:
Category | Tuition Fee | Development Fee | Other Fees | Total Payable at Admission |
---|---|---|---|---|
Open | INR 77,000 | INR 24,674 | INR 45,030 | INR 146,704 |
EWS/OBC | INR 38,500 | INR 24,674 | INR 45,030 | INR 108,204 (post-reimbursement) |
SC/ST | - | - | INR 1,000 | INR 1,000 (caution deposit) |
TFWS | - | INR 24,674 | INR 45,030 | INR 69,704 |
